You (yellow), need to pass the red ball to your friend (blue), as you both sit on a merry-go-round. I posted a similar animation of this problem before- and this one shows quite an extreme of the solution. You can only throw the ball very slowly, so you throw the ball to where your friend will be when it gets to them. From above, the ball travels in a straight line, but in the world of the spinning merry-go-round that you occupy- the ball seems to be warped on a curve by some invisible forces. These invisible forces are called the Coriolis and Centrifugal effects. [code] [more]
